WebSep 26, 2016 · Before you can know if you're eligible for federal funds to help pay for college, you need to complete the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A). The FAFSA is the common denominator in all federal aid, including grants, loans, and work-study support. WebNov 3, 2024 · The first step is to file the Free Application for Federal Student Aid, known as the FAFSA. This application is used by many state agencies and schools to determine college aid.
